The Evolution of Pet Enrichment: From Physical to Digital

Traditionally, pet enrichment centered on physical toys, environmental modifications, and interactive play. However, with advances in mobile technology, digital solutions are now augmenting these efforts. Apps designed specifically for pet engagement serve not only to entertain but also to monitor health, facilitate training, and even stimulate cognitive functions.

These innovations are grounded in behavioral science: cognitive stimulation can reduce stress, prevent behavioral issues, and enhance overall quality of life for pets (Mikulski et al., 2019). Case Study: Digital Habitrails and Interactive Pet Environments

Analogous to the classic hamster or rat ‘Habitrail’, today’s digital habitat systems aim to simulate stimulating environments remotely or via mobile interfaces. These systems incorporate elements of physical enrichment with digital components, tracking activities, and providing customizable challenges for pets.

For example, advanced applications now leverage augmented reality (AR), motion sensors, and interactive games to challenge pets, promote exercise, and provide mental stimulation. They serve as extensions of the physical internal environment of homes or specialized enclosures, translating the concept of traditional Habitrails into digitally enhanced ecosystems.
